- The distance between Debrecen, Hungary and Miyakonojo, Japan is approximately 8,751 km or 5,438 mi.
- To reach Debrecen in this distance one would set out from Miyakonojo bearing 319.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Debrecen bearing 234.9° or SW .
- Debrecen has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Miyakonojo has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Debrecen is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Miyakonojo is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ome.
- The average temperature is 6 °C (10.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.8 °C (3.2°F) more in Debrecen.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1829.7 mm (72 in) less which is equivalent to 1829.7 l/m² (44.91 US gal/ft²) or 18,297,000 l/ha (1,956,071 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.8° lower in Debrecen than in Miyakonojo.
- Relative humidity levels are 1.2%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.1°C (11°F) lower.
